I just made the exact same switch a week ago...from Nextel to Verizon. I did pick up the LG VX7000 (black) for $99 (after rebate) and absolutely love it thus far. I'm not huge into camera phones myself (really no need) but all the reviews of the VX7000 were excellent so I opted to go with it. Good choice in my opinion. It'll take a few days to get used to the navigation compared to Nextel, but it's pretty simple. Call quality is excellent, small enough to fit in your front jeans pocket. Oh, and unlike Nextel...this phone actually gets a signal! When I had my I730 I had to charge it at least every other day, no matter if I used it or not. The battery life on the 7000 is far superior.
I give it two thumbs up for sure. Hope this helps.
